Riavviare MariaDB da script in Linux

Mattepuffo's logo
Riavviare MariaDB da script in Linux

Riavviare MariaDB da script in Linux

Ho un sito su hosting con server virtuale con Linux che ogni tanto crasha.

Probabilmente c'è troppo traffico; al momento non ho la possibilità di aumentare le risorse e quindi ogni volta devo collegarmi ed riavviare MariaDB.

La cosa è scomoda, quindi ho creato uno scriptino BASH che mi controlla in automatico se il servizio è attivo; in caso lo riavvia.

Questo lo script:

#!/bin/bash

UP=$(pgrep mysql | wc -l);
if [ "$UP" -ne 1 ];
then
        echo "DB spento";
        sudo service mysql start

else
        echo "Tutto ok";
fi

Ovviamente il comando da dare varia a seconda della dsitro; qui parliamo di Ubuntu, ma in caso basterà mettere il comando corretto.

Fatto questo dovete creare un cron in modo da avviare lo script in autonomia.

Enjoy!


Condividi su Facebook

Commentami!